What is a 3D medical animator?

A 3D Medical Animation job involves creating detailed, scientifically accurate animations that visualize medical concepts, procedures, and biological processes. These animations are used for education, training, marketing, and patient communication in the healthcare and pharmaceutical industries. Professionals in this field combine expertise in animation software, medical science, and storytelling to produce engaging visuals. They often collaborate with doctors, researchers, and educators to ensure accuracy and clarity.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a 3D medical animator?

To thrive in 3D Medical Animation, you need expertise in 3D modeling, animation, and a strong grasp of medical and anatomical concepts, typically supported by a degree in biomedical visualization, animation, or a related field. Proficiency with software such as Autodesk Maya, Cinema 4D, ZBrush, Adobe Creative Suite, and familiarity with rendering engines is highly beneficial, as are certifications like Certified Medical Illustrator (CMI). Attention to detail, strong communication, and the ability to work collaboratively with medical professionals and clients are essential soft skills. These skills ensure accurate, visually compelling animations that effectively communicate complex medical information to diverse audiences.

What typical projects do 3D medical animators work on, and how do they collaborate with healthcare professionals?

3D Medical Animators frequently work on projects such as patient education videos, surgical procedure visualizations, pharmaceutical product demonstrations, and scientific illustrations for research presentations. Collaboration with healthcare professionals, such as doctors, researchers, and medical writers, is common to ensure scientific accuracy and clear communication of complex concepts. Animators often participate in team meetings to gather input, revise animations based on expert feedback, and align their work with project objectives. This teamwork-driven environment provides opportunities to learn about medical advancements and contribute to important educational and clinical initiatives.

Job description

Explico is seeking senior level visualization professionals for our Detroit or Denver office.

WHO WE ARE

Explico is an employee-owned forensic engineering firm dedicated to uncovering the truth through scientific rigor and objective analysis. In an industry increasingly shaped by financial interests, we remain focused on the integrity of our work, the people who do it, and the long-term impact we leave behind. Our multidisciplinary team—spanning accident reconstruction, biomechanics, human factors, and more—comes together around a shared commitment to the craft of investigation, not just the business of it.

We are proud to lead the development of the next generation of experts.

WHAT YOU’LL DO

Explico is looking for a talented Senior Artist in our Detroit or Denver offices. We are a forensic engineering firm and often create visualizations to both assist in our analysis as well as present to jurors in trial. We are looking for someone who can work with our engineers to effectively perform and communicate our analyses in a visually pleasing manner.

Please be aware that this position involves imagery and visualizations depicting accidents, injuries, and/or fatalities. Candidates should be comfortable working with this content.

This is a hybrid position, requiring work at the office at least three days per week. Explico believes that in-person interaction is critical to our teamwork-centric culture.

WHAT WE’RE LOOKING FOR

The ideal candidate will be familiar with handling all aspects of the 3D workflow from modeling, lighting, texturing, animation, and rendering. We are looking for the type of person that has a strong attention to detail and is capable of effectively managing multiple projects and tight deadlines.

EXPERIENCE AND REQUIRED SKILLS
  • Experience and/or formal education in 3D computer graphics as a technical artist
  • Blender experience (Other software can be used for asset creation, but the final scene will be in and rendered from Blender.)
  • 3D animation experience (largely mechanical animation, for example an explainer video on how bicycle brakes work)
  • Environment creation (hard surface modeling required, no kit bashing)
  • Ablity to take a project from start to finish
ADDITIONAL SKILLS
  • Camera tracking experience a plus (PFTrack, Syntheyes or manual tracking)
  • Unreal/Unity experience a plus
  • Additional technical education in math and science would be helpful
WHAT WE OFFER
  • Competitive compensation and benefits with quarterly and annual bonus opportunities
  • Training in advanced simulation tools and techniques
  • Paid time off (10 holidays, 15 vacation days, 10 sick days)
  • 401(k) match up to 6%
  • Full healthcare coverage (medical, vision, and dental)
  • Life and disability insurance
  • Educational assistance program
  • Work on nationally visible, high-impact cases

Starting salary range for this position is $80,000 to $120,000 annually, depending on qualifications and experience.
